Ingredients

  • 0.8 cup garlic aïoli store-bought
  • small bunch basil 
  • 0.8 cup basil pesto 
  • 0.5 pound baby mozzarella balls 
  • ounces pancetta 
  • 1.5 pounds savory vegetable 
  • pound genoa salami sliced
  • pound shrimp cooked
  • 0.3 cup sun-dried olives 

Equipment

  • toothpicks
  • skewers

Directions

  1. Fab it up: Wrap mozzarella with strips of prosciutto; spear with toothpick along with 1/2 of a sun-dried tomato plus 1 basil leaf.
  2. Serve with pesto for dipping.
  3. Fab it up: Arrange the salami on a platter and slice and skewer vegetables. Grind some black pepper over aioli; serve with shrimp.
